Being on drugs affects people's ability to drive and makes them a hazard on the road, even if others don’t agree for health reasons. The involvement of drugs is seen throughout many drivers; whether it be by prescription or not. Misusing drugs changes your capability of driving in a dreadful way. The NCADD declared, “According to the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ration’s (NHTSA) National Roadside Survey, more than 16% of weekend, nighttime drivers tested positive for illegal, prescription, or over-the-counter medications (11% tested positive for illegal drugs).”(Driving while Impaired n.p.). Multiple people go out on the weekends making the possibility of an accident more likely. The use of drugs can correlate to the effect of alcohol. The NIH explained, drug abuse and misuse of prescriptions makes driving unsafe and is compared to drunk driving as it puts everyone on the road at risk (Drugged driving n.p.). Abusing the use of prescription drugs is a form of distraction as well as drugs that are more commonly known throughout the world. According to the NIH, research provided after an accident showed the use of nicotine, alcoholic drinks, and over the counter painkillers taken by the driver (Drugged Driving n.p.). People today claim they use technology for communicable reasons in the car, but this type of distraction is nonetheless unsafe. Cell phones are the biggest culprits for technological distractions while driving. In fact, the NHTSA gave information stating,”An estimated 34,000 people were injured in 2013 in crashes involving cell phone use or other cell phone-related activities, 8 percent of all people injured in distraction-affected crashes.”(Distracted Driving 2013 4). The effects that cellular device distractions has on driver results in many deaths. According to the NHTSA, in the year of 2013, 14 percent of death causing accidents were due to the use of cell phones as a distraction which, in total, was 411 fatal crashes (Distracted Driving 2013 1).
